The thicker the film, the better?

Many believe that a “thicker film” automatically means “stronger protection.” In reality, thickness is not the sole determining factor of film performance.

Stretch film effectiveness depends on multiple variables:

  • Elongation capacity
  • Cling strength
  • Mechanical durability

Increasing thickness can lead to higher raw material costs and unnecessary plastic use. Without optimizing other technical properties, a thicker film may still underperform compared to high-tech, thinner alternatives.

Stretch film can only stretch up to 200%?

Traditional films typically have elongation rates between 70% and 100%, resulting in high material consumption.

However, advanced technologies now allow for elongation up to 200%–250%. This means the film can be stretched multiple times before being applied to a pallet - while still maintaining strength and consistency. As a result, businesses can significantly reduce the amount of film used per unit of product while improving load stability during transportation and storage.

Choosing the right film with an appropriate stretch ratio for your wrapping machine is key to optimizing material usage and reducing per-pallet packaging costs.

Manual wrapping saves more than machine wrapping?

Due to concerns over machine investment costs, many businesses still rely on manual wrapping to “save money.” However, this decision is often based solely on the unit price of the film roll - ignoring the real cost per pallet.

While manual wrapping may seem flexible and cost-effective upfront, it introduces multiple inefficiencies: inconsistent stretch and tension, increased labor time and costs, high material waste due to poor film control.

In contrast, combining high-performance stretch film with automatic or semi-automatic wrapping machines allows businesses to: precisely control tension, stretch ratio, and wrap cycles, improve overall packaging efficiency, significantly reduce per-pallet costs.

Cheap stretch film means cost savings?

Opting for low-cost stretch film is a common attempt at saving money—but it comes with hidden risks. Cheap films often suffer from: inconsistent material quality, poor elongation, weak cling, low mechanical strength.

To compensate for these flaws, users are forced to increase wrap layers or switch to thicker films to ensure load stability. This leads to: increased material costs, longer packaging times, higher risk of damage during transport. In total, the actual cost per pallet may exceed that of using premium, high-quality films.

Does a neat wrap mean a secure pallet?

A common mistake is judging pallet quality based only on the outer appearance of the wrap. This visual assessment can be misleading.

An effective wrapping process must ensure: load stability, protection from dust, shock, and vibration, optimized material usage. To properly assess wrap performance, apply real-world tests such as: vibration test, acceleration test, simulated transport scenarios.

Can you really reduce film usage by over 50%?

Some companies remain skeptical that film consumption can be reduced by 50% without compromising performance. But it’s entirely achievable with a fully optimized packaging process.

Savings depend not just on thickness, but also on: high stretchability, film consistency, compatibility with the wrapping machine.

Low-performance films often require more wrap layers to stabilize the load, increasing cost. In contrast, high-tech stretch films with 200–250% stretch ratio reduce usage while maintaining load integrity—optimizing logistics costs.
